Team Leader Clinical
JWM Neurology, PC
Description Job Title: Team Leader – Clinical Offices Date: June 25, 2020 Type: This is a full-time position, days and hours of work are Monday-Friday 8 a.m.-5p.m. Supervision Received: Reports to Office Manager Supervision Exercised: Assists office manager with staff supervision. Assumes all duties of office manager when he/she is absent. Classification: Nonexempt Summary/Objective: Responsible for supporting the office manager and directing, planning, and helping with coordinating all clerical, clinical and administrative office activities. Essential Functions: Oversees daily office operations and delegates authority to assigned staff member, when the office manager is absent or at the request of manager. Helps with staff scheduling and any personnel issues at the request of manager. Executes office payroll and PTO requests. Ensures that patients are treated courteously by office staff and that other visitors are screened and directed properly. Opens physician and APP schedules and blocks them accordingly at the request of the Manager. Approves all charge/receipt summaries, deposit slips, and cash collections before it is sent to the Business Office. Understands and manages the physician and advance practice providers schedules to achieve optimal patient flow based on provider preference. High level of patient service management knowledge and methods to manage critical conversations and patient needs. Screens calls; follows clinic guidelines, directs appropriately to Physicians, other medical personnel, administrators and support staff. Keeps records of call logs. Takes messages following guidelines related to timeliness and accuracy and processes appropriately. Places and return calls for patient concerns. Handles clerical work associated with incoming referrals, including insurance verification and demographic information, from outside medical sources. Other duties as assigned. The jobholder must demonstrate current competencies applicable to the job position. Education: High school diploma or GED; CMA, RMA, ABR-OE or QMA (or equivalent) REQUIRED. Experience: Minimum three years of Front Office, or Call Center supervisory experience required, including one year in medical office. Knowledge: Knowledge of organizational policies, procedures, and systems. Knowledge working with electronic health records (EHR/EMR) or healthcare related computer systems. Knowledge of patient confidentiality and HIPAA regulations. Knowledge of clinic office procedures. Knowledge of computer systems and applications. Knowledge of medical practices, terminology, and reimbursement policies. Knowledge of grammar, spelling, punctuation and sentence structure to answer Correspondence and prepare reports. Knowledge of phone reporting capabilities and analysis of work flow and call management Skills: Must be able to demonstrate critical thinking skills. Demonstrated skills in planning, delegating and supervising Highly competent in problem solving and decision-making. Skill in planning, organizing, delegating and supervising. Skill in evaluating the effectiveness of existing methods and procedures. Skill in operating a variety of office equipment and computer programs. Skill in problem solving and decision-making. Abilities: Ability to read, interpret and apply policies and procedures. Ability to communicate clearly and effectively. Ability to set priorities among multiple requests. Ability to interact with patients, medical and administrative staff, public effectively. Travel: Some travel by personal vehicle may be required. Must have valid driver's license and current auto insurance. Standard mileage reimbursement provided by the Organization. Work Environment: This job operates in a clerical, office setting within a confined cubical area. This role routinely uses standard office equipment such as computers, phones, photocopiers, filing cabinets and fax machines. Physical Demands: The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. This role requires one to sit, stand and walk for 8-9 hours per day. This would require the ability to lift objects up to 50 lbs., open filing cabinets and bend or stand on a stool as necessary. This role requires full range of motion, manual dexterity, and hand-eye coordination. This description is intended to provide only basic guidelines for meeting job requirements.
